<h2><a id="_g14tf14kp624"></a><strong>Why Longevity Requires Careful Structuring</strong></h2>
<p>Living longer is something most of us welcome, reflecting improvements in healthcare, nutrition and quality of life. Yet it also changes the financial framework we need to consider. In Singapore, the statutory retirement age has been gradually rising, with the minimum currently set at 65 and expected to reach 70 by 2030. At the same time, many people express a wish to retire earlier than that, even though confidence in having sufficient savings to do so comfortably is often low. Nearly <a href="https://www.straitstimes.com/business/invest/retirement-financial-planning-quality-of-life-report-hsbc-singapore"><strong>six in ten Singaporeans</strong></a> say they expect to work past the official retirement age because of financial concerns such as rising costs and healthcare expenses.</p>
<p>This broader context highlights how longevity reshapes retirement planning. A retirement that stretches 20, 25 or even 30 years requires more than a simple nest egg; it requires structure. A lump sum sitting in an account may not be sufficient if it is drawn down too quickly or without a clear plan. In fact, estimates suggest a comfortable retirement in Singapore can cost significantly more than many expect, depending on lifestyle and how long you live beyond retirement age.</p>
<p>Careful income planning helps balance this reality. Instead of relying solely on accumulated capital, retirement resources can be organised to generate sustainable payouts over time. That might involve combining monthly payouts from retirement schemes, planned withdrawals from personal savings, and other income streams. This structured approach helps ensure that the financial means you have built can support you not just at the start of retirement, but across later stages of life when priorities and costs may shift.</p>
<h2><a id="_2i56pqjd4u2v"></a><strong>Healthcare Costs in Retirement: A Practical Reality</strong></h2>
<p>Healthcare expenses in retirement rarely appear as a single, dramatic bill. More often, they accumulate gradually. Regular visits to specialists, long-term medication, diagnostic tests, physiotherapy, or home-based support may become part of everyday life as the years progress.</p>
<p>Recent discussions about retirement adequacy in Singapore have highlighted medical costs as one of the key concerns affecting confidence about retirement readiness. Even when Central Provident Fund (CPF) savings and national healthcare schemes provide a foundation, out-of-pocket expenses can still arise. Co-payments, non-subsidised treatments, and longer-term care needs may place ongoing pressure on monthly cash flow.</p>
<p>For this reason, healthcare cannot be treated as a secondary consideration within retirement financial planning. It is closely linked to the sustainability of your overall plan. Practical reflection helps clarify the picture:</p>
<ul>
<li>How might medical needs change over a 20- to 30-year retirement horizon?</li>
<li>If a prolonged health condition develops, how would that affect both income and daily living costs?</li>
<li>Would higher healthcare costs reduce the funds available for lifestyle choices, travel or family support?</li>
</ul>
<p>Planning does not eliminate uncertainty, but it can reduce financial strain when circumstances change. Some individuals consider tools such as <a href="https://www.income.com.sg/savings-and-investments/gro-retire-flex-pro-ii"><strong>insurance for retirement</strong></a> or specific <a href="https://www.income.com.sg/health-insurance/primeshield"><strong>insurance plans for seniors</strong></a> as part of a broader strategy. These arrangements are not substitutes for savings. Rather, they can help manage certain risks that might otherwise erode accumulated resources over time.</p>
<p>Approaching healthcare costs as an ongoing financial factor, rather than an isolated possibility, allows retirement planning to reflect the realities of longer life expectancy more accurately.</p>

<h2>Navigating HMRC Rules and Pension Legislation</h2>
<p>The rules set by HM Revenue and Customs directly shape the options available to individuals at retirement. Understanding this framework is crucial for compliant financial planning.</p>
<p>Specific <strong>HMRC rules</strong> dictate how funds can move. For instance, a payment from exercising one&#8217;s right to shop around cannot be accepted into a <strong><span>drawdown plan</span></strong>. It must be used to purchase a lifetime income product instead.</p>
<h3>Understanding Drawdown, Transfers and Exit Charges</h3>
<p>A <strong>scheme</strong> can only accept a <strong><span>transfer</span></strong> if it is structured as a drawdown-to-drawdown movement. The <strong><span>ceding scheme</span></strong> typically places the balance into its own arrangement first.</p>
<p>Protective <strong>legislation</strong> caps exit fees at 1%. This cap applied from March 2017 for personal <strong><span>pensions</span></strong> and October 2017 for occupational ones.</p>
<h3>Interpreting Regulatory Guidelines for Pension Transfers</h3>
<p>Trustees may use a permissive <strong>override</strong> to allow more flexible <strong><span>payments</span></strong>. This is not mandatory, so <strong><span>members</span></strong> should check their scheme&#8217;s stance.</p>
<p>Moving to a personal arrangement usually means losing a Guaranteed Minimum Pension <strong>entitlement</strong>. The entire value converts to ordinary rights within the <strong><span>receiving scheme</span></strong>.</p>
<p>Since October 2020, certain movements are classified as switches, not full <strong>transfers</strong>. This change affects the advice required.</p>

<h2>Understanding Annuities and Their Role in Retirement</h2>
<p>A key decision for pension savers is how to transform their accumulated savings into reliable monthly payments. This is where an annuity often enters the picture.</p>
<h3>What is an Annuity?</h3>
<p>An annuity is a financial product. You exchange a pension lump sum with an insurance provider. In return, they promise a regular, <strong>guaranteed income</strong> for the rest of your life or a fixed term.</p>
<p>This swap turns your pension pot into a predictable stream of money. It continues regardless of how long you live, offering true longevity insurance.</p>
<h3>Advantages and Disadvantages of Annuities</h3>
<p>The primary benefit is <strong>certainty</strong>. Your income does not rely on investment markets or a depleting pot. It provides peace of mind and simple budgeting.</p>
<p>If you live a very long life, you may ultimately receive more money than you originally paid in. This is a powerful safeguard.</p>
<p>However, the regular payment may be lower than potential returns from other pension access methods, like drawdown. It is a trade-off for security.</p>
<p><em>Crucially, the decision is irreversible.</em> Once you purchase this product, you cannot reclaim your lump sum if your needs change. It is vital to be certain it is the right way forward for your retirement.</p>

<h2>Types of Annuities to Consider</h2>
<p>The UK market offers a range of annuity types, catering to diverse personal circumstances. Understanding these options is key to selecting the right product for your retirement.</p>
<h3>Lifetime Annuities</h3>
<p>A standard lifetime annuity is the most common type. It provides a regular income for the rest of your life.</p>
<p>You can choose a flat-rate product that pays the same amount each year. Alternatively, an increasing income annuity rises annually. This can be by a set percentage or linked to inflation, protecting your purchasing power.</p>
<h3>Joint Life Annuities</h3>
<p>This product type offers security for couples. It continues paying an income to a spouse or dependant after the holder dies.</p>
<p>You have an option for the full payment to continue. Often, a reduced amount, such as 50%, is selected to secure a higher initial income.</p>
<h3>Enhanced and Fixed-Term Annuities</h3>
<p>Enhanced annuities offer a higher income. They are designed for people with long-term medical conditions or certain lifestyle factors.</p>
<p>Fixed-term annuities guarantee income for a specific period, typically five to ten years. After this term, a maturity sum is paid. This money can then be used for other retirement plans.</p>
<h2>Factors Affecting Your Annuity Rates</h2>
<p>Your personal circumstances and broader economic conditions directly influence the annuity rates available to you. The guaranteed income you secure depends on several key factors.</p>
<p>These include the size of your pension pot, your age, the provider&#8217;s prevailing rates, and your state of health. Understanding these elements is crucial for effective retirement planning.</p>
<h3>Impact of Interest Rates and Market Trends</h3>
<p>Annuity rates are closely tied to interest rates in the wider economy. Providers typically invest in government bonds to fund future income payments.</p>
<p>When the Bank of England base rate rises, bond yields often increase. This, in turn, boosts the annuity rates providers can offer.</p>
<p>UK annuity rates reached a 14-year high during 2022. This made guaranteed income considerably more attractive than in previous years of low interest.</p>
<p>A rate is expressed as an annual percentage of the amount you invest. For example, a 6% annuity rate on £100,000 provides £6,000 yearly income.</p>
<h3>Personal Health and Age Considerations</h3>
<p>Your age at the time of purchase is a primary factor. Older individuals generally receive higher annuity rates due to a shorter life expectancy.</p>
<p>Health factors can substantially increase your annuity rate. Conditions like diabetes, heart disease, or lifestyle factors like smoking may qualify you for an enhanced annuity.</p>
<p>This offers a significantly higher income for life. Different providers assess these personal factors differently.</p>
<p><strong>Shopping around the market is essential.</strong> Comparing quotes can result in a noticeably better rate, potentially adding tens of thousands to your lifetime income.</p>

<h2><a id="_8h967fv0ta98"><strong></strong></a><strong>Signal One: The Monthly Close Takes Longer Than Two Days</strong></h2>
<p>A clean set of books should close within a couple of days of month-end. Bank and credit card accounts get reconciled, accounts payable and receivable get reviewed, journal entries get booked, and the financial statements get generated. If your monthly close routinely drags into the third week of the following month or doesn&#8217;t really happen at all, you&#8217;re not running a business with current information. You&#8217;re running it on a guess.</p>
<p>Late closes also compound. A messy June makes July harder to reconcile, and by the time September rolls around, the books reflect a quarter of guesswork. Catching that up later costs significantly more than maintaining it cleanly month to month.</p>
<h2><a id="_xb67d78e8jc9"><strong></strong></a><strong>Signal Two: Bank Reconciliations Are More Than 30 Days Behind</strong></h2>
<p>Bank reconciliation is the foundation of accurate books. If your reconciliations are 30, 60, or 90 days out of date, you genuinely don&#8217;t know what your business has spent or earned. Duplicate transactions, missed deposits, and unrecorded fees sit in the accounting system distorting every report it produces.</p>
<p>Owners often assume their bank balance is the truth. It isn&#8217;t, not for accounting purposes. The reconciled book balance is the truth, and a business that hasn&#8217;t done a real reconciliation in a quarter is making decisions on financial fiction.</p>
<h2><a id="_un3npib3o74q"><strong></strong></a><strong>Signal Three: Sales Tax Filings Have Started to Scare You</strong></h2>
<p>Sales tax compliance has become significantly harder since the 2018 Wayfair decision allowed states to require remote sellers to collect tax based on economic nexus. An ecommerce business selling across 30 states can now have filing obligations in a dozen jurisdictions, each with its own rules, rates, and deadlines. The IRS publishes federal guidance, but state and local sales tax compliance lives in a patchwork that changes constantly.</p>
<p>If you&#8217;ve started avoiding the sales tax dashboard in your accounting software, or if you&#8217;re filing late and paying penalties, that&#8217;s a clear signal the bookkeeping has outgrown the owner. This is one of the areas where a professional bookkeeper or fractional CFO pays for itself within the first quarter just by getting filings clean and on time.</p>
<h2><a id="_ufnja4nz8rz7"><strong></strong></a><strong>Signal Four: Accounts Receivable Are Aging Past 60 Days Without Anyone Noticing</strong></h2>
<p>For service businesses and B2B companies, AR aging is one of the most reliable indicators that the books aren&#8217;t being managed. An invoice that hits 60 days past due is statistically harder to collect than one at 30. By 90 days, the probability of full collection drops sharply. A bookkeeper who runs an aging report every Monday catches problems while they&#8217;re still fixable.</p>
<p>Owners who handle their own books tend to notice cash flow pressure long before they notice the underlying AR problem. The receivables have been slipping for months by the time anyone looks at the report.</p>
<h2><a id="_7g6jk148eso5"><strong></strong></a><strong>Signal Five: The &#8220;I&#8217;ll Catch Up This Weekend&#8221; Pile Never Actually Gets Caught Up</strong></h2>
<p>The receipts in the glove box. The unrecognized charges sitting in the bank feed. The folder of vendor bills you&#8217;ve been meaning to enter. The expense report your spouse filled out from last quarter&#8217;s trade show. If this list looks familiar, the bookkeeping has stopped being a weekend task and started being a permanent backlog.</p>
<p>The math on this is rarely in the owner&#8217;s favor. Eight hours a month of owner time spent on bookkeeping at, say, an effective hourly value of $150 to $250, comes out to $1,200 to $2,000 per month in opportunity cost. Outsourced bookkeeping for a typical small business runs less than that, often substantially less, and you get cleaner books in the bargain.</p>
<h2><a id="_q65363t8gyqu"><strong></strong></a><strong>Why DIY Bookkeeping Costs More Than Owners Realize</strong></h2>
<p>A business doing $500K in annual revenue with disorganized books almost always loses more in missed deductions, late fees, lender penalties, and bad decisions than it would cost to outsource the work. The IRS doesn&#8217;t care that you were busy. State sales tax authorities don&#8217;t care that you forgot. Lenders looking at sloppy financial statements either decline the loan or offer worse terms. Buyers evaluating a business with messy books either walk away or discount the offer significantly.</p>
<p>The cost of bad bookkeeping is rarely a single line item. It shows up as a missed home office deduction, a misclassified vehicle expense, a lender requiring additional collateral because the financials are unclear, or a tax bill that&#8217;s higher than it should be because the books couldn&#8217;t substantiate legitimate deductions.</p>

<h2>What Makes Singapore Shares a Solid Investment Choice</h2>
<p>Singapore shares are listed on the Singapore Exchange, one of the most reputable stock markets in Asia. SGX operates under a robust regulatory framework overseen by the Monetary Authority of Singapore, giving investors a level of transparency and legal protection that underpins confidence in the market.</p>
<p>The companies listed on SGX span a wide range of industries. Banking and financial services, real estate investment trusts, telecommunications, healthcare, consumer goods, and industrials all have significant representation. Many of these businesses operate not just in Singapore but across Southeast Asia and beyond, giving investors in Singapore shares indirect exposure to broader regional growth.</p>
<p>Singapore shares are also attractive from a tax perspective. There is no capital gains tax on profits realised from stock investments, and individual investors receive dividend payments without withholding tax deductions. These structural advantages make the effective return on Singapore shares more favourable than many other markets in the region when all factors are accounted for.</p>

<h3>CDP Linkage for Legal Ownership of Singapore Shares</h3>
<p>A credible platform for trading Singapore shares must support CDP linkage. The Central Depository is the official system through which share ownership is recorded in Singapore, and through which dividend payments and corporate actions are processed. Without a linked CDP account, shares you purchase are not formally registered in your name under the SGX framework.</p>
